The UK’s CPIH y/y for July came in at 2.8%, according to data released today. This figure was below the consensus expectation of 2.9% and marked a decrease from the previous reading of 3.0%. The actual print represented a -3.4% surprise when compared to the market consensus.
Following the release, the British Pound saw varied initial reactions across major pairs. GBPUSD moved up 7.2 pips within 5 minutes, settling at a 3.0 pip gain after 15 minutes. GBPAUD gained 3.5 pips initially, then was up 0.9 pips after 15 minutes. GBPCAD saw an initial rise of 5.9 pips, then was up 1.7 pips after 15 minutes. GBPJPY climbed 11 pips in the first 5 minutes, then was up 3.7 pips after 15 minutes. GBPNZD also rose 11 pips initially, then was up 4.5 pips after 15 minutes. EURGBP initially dipped 1.9 pips, then returned to 0.0 pips after 15 minutes. GBPCHF gained 2.8 pips initially, then was down 0.5 pips after 15 minutes. These initial moves were generally small when compared to the median 1-hour moves observed after past releases, which typically range from 11 pips for EURGBP to 21 pips for GBPNZD and GBPCAD.
